Devil’s Thumb Ranch

The Devil’s Thumb Ranch is located just north of Winter Park in beautiful Tabernash, Colorado. With almost 120 kilometers of trails in the Ranch Creek Valley on the Continental Divide, Devil’s Thumb is a hot-spot for cross country skiing and snowshoeing.

If you need instruction, you can start the day with a private or group lesson. If all you need is a quick refresher, head out to their advanced technique clinics. Don’t have your own gear? No problem! The ranch offers quality cross country ski equipment for purchase or rental – including child sleds and skijoring rigs.

Tennessee Pass Nordic Center

Head to the charming town of Leadville, Colorado to hit the Tennessee Pass Nordic Trail. With over 27 kilometers of set track and wide skate lanes on a groomed trail system, the Tennessee Pass Nordic Center offers terrain for every style and ability. Take in the stunning views of the Sawatch Mountains as you make your way across the trail!

Crested Butte Nordic Center

Head to Crested Butte for more than 50 kilometers of nordic trails that wind through the outskirts of the town and into the backcounty. The trails feature flats, rolling terrain and hills that provide a challenge and adventure for all skill levels. Make sure to reserve a spot at the Magic Meadows Yurt for a gourmet backcountry dinner and make a day of it!

Keystone Nordic Center

For the all-inclusive Nordic experience, head to the Keystone Nordic Center. There you can get gear rentals and take a lesson or guided tour in in snowshoeing, skate skiing, cross-country skiing on the trails amassing 16 kilometers and access to 27 more kilometers nearby in the White River National Forest.

Vail Nordic Center

The Vail Nordic Center is home to 17 kilometers of cross-country and skate skiing, as well as 10 kilometers of showshoeing trails. Rentals and lessons are also available at this Nordic center located in the heart of Vail. The trails are great for skiers from beginner to advanced, and the center even offers video analysis to improve technique.

Aspen/Snowmass Nordic Trail System

The Aspen / Snowmass Nordic Trail System boasts 80 kilometers of groomed trails, making it one of the largest free cross-country skiing and snowshoeing networks in North America. Travel between the  system’s hubs in Aspen and Snowmass, and pass through wooded areas, hilly golf courses and peaceful valleys along the way.
